Wingate, N.C.----The fourth-ranked Wingate University Bulldogs rolled to a 7-0 victory over the visiting Trojans of the University of Mount Olive in NCAA Division II men's tennis action Friday afternoon. Wingate improves to 2-0 on the season, while the Trojans fall to 3-2 overall.
